Locate indicator and button (white)
|
You can turn on the Locate indicator to identify a particular
server. When lit, the LED displays as a fast blink. The blinking
will time out after 15 minutes. Turn on the Locate indicator by
pressing the Locate button, or see Locate the
Server.
|
2
|
System Fault (Service Action Required) LED (amber)
|
Under some fault conditions, individual component fault LEDs
are lit in addition to the Service Required LED.
|
3
|
System OK indicator (green)
|
Indicates these conditions:
-
Off – Server
is not running in its normal state. Server power might
be off. The SP might be running.
-
Steady on –
Server is powered on and is running in its normal
operating state. No service actions are required.
-
Slow blink –
A normal but transitory activity is taking place. Slow
blinking might indicate that server diagnostics are
running or that the server is booting.
-
Standby blink
– Server is running in standby mode and can be
quickly returned to full function.
|

SP OK indicator
|
Indicates these conditions:
-
Off – AC
power might not have been connected to the power
supplies, or an SPM error has occurred and service is
required.
-
Steady on –
SP is running in its normal operating state. No service
actions are required.
-
Slow Blink –
SP is initializing the Oracle ILOM firmware.
|
6
|
Fan Module Fault LED (amber)
|
Indicates these conditions:
-
Off – Steady
state, no service action is required.
-
Steady on – A
fan module failure event has been acknowledged and a
service action is required on at least one of the fan
modules.
|
7
|
Server Power Supply Fault LED (amber)
|
Indicates these conditions:
-
Off – Steady
state, no service action is required.
-
Steady on – A
fault has been detected on one of the two power
supplies.
|
8
|
Server Overtemp LED (amber)
|
Indicates these conditions:
-
Off – Steady
state, no service action is required.
-
Steady on – A
temperature failure event has been acknowledged. A
temperature limit has been exceeded, and a service
action is required.
